Understanding the Role of a Senior Real Estate Specialist

A Senior Real Estate Specialist (SRES) is uniquely trained to assist seniors in navigating the often complex landscape of real estate transactions. With a focus on the specific needs and challenges faced by older adults, SRES agents stand out for their expertise and commitment to providing exceptional service tailored to senior clients.

The responsibilities of a Senior Real Estate Specialist extend beyond traditional real estate transactions. They are equipped to understand the emotional and financial implications of buying or selling a home for seniors. Their qualifications often include specialized training in areas such as senior housing options, aging in place, and the unique legal considerations that may arise in real estate transactions involving seniors. This specialized knowledge is crucial in ensuring that seniors receive guidance that is not only informed but also empathetic.

Certifications and Designations in Senior Services

The array of certifications and designations available for Senior Services Experts highlights their commitment to professionalism and knowledge. Understanding these can help clients choose someone with the right expertise:

  • Senior Real Estate Specialist (SRES): This certification focuses on the unique needs of seniors in real estate transactions.
  • Certified Aging-in-Place Specialist (CAPS): This designation emphasizes modifications and home improvements for seniors.
  • Certified Senior Advisor (CSA): A comprehensive program that covers various aspects of senior needs across industries.
  • National Association of Senior Move Managers (NASMM) Certification: Specializes in transition services for older adults relocating.

Step-by-Step Process of Selling a Home

Working with an SRES agent involves several key steps aimed at providing clarity and support throughout the selling journey. The following Artikels this process:

1. Initial Consultation: The SRES agent meets with the homeowner to discuss their needs, expectations, and timeline for selling the home. This is an opportunity to address any concerns and set the groundwork for the selling strategy.

2. Home Evaluation: The agent conducts a comparative market analysis (CMA) to assess the home’s value. This analysis takes into account recent sales in the area, current market conditions, and the unique features of the property.

3. Preparing the Home for Sale: This includes recommending necessary repairs and enhancements. Staging the home can significantly impact its appeal. An SRES agent utilizes staging techniques tailored to senior clients, focusing on decluttering, enhancing natural light, and creating inviting spaces.

4. Marketing Strategy: The SRES agent develops a robust marketing plan. This may involve professional photography, virtual tours, and online listings on platforms frequented by potential buyers. The strategy will also include traditional marketing methods, such as open houses and printed materials.

5. Showings and Open Houses: The agent coordinates and conducts showings, ensuring the homeowner is comfortable throughout the process. Feedback from potential buyers is gathered to adjust strategies if necessary.

6. Negotiation and Offers: Once offers are received, the SRES agent advocates for the seller, negotiating terms that best meet the homeowner’s needs. This includes discussing contingencies, closing dates, and any requested repairs.

7. Closing the Sale: The SRES agent guides the seller through the closing process, ensuring all paperwork is in order. They assist in understanding the financial aspects, including any tax implications related to the sale.

Timeline Highlighting Important Milestones

Having a clear timeline helps manage expectations and prepares sellers for each phase of the process. Below are the typical milestones during the selling process:

– Week 1-2: Initial consultation and home evaluation.
– Week 3: Home preparations, including repairs and staging.
– Week 4: Launching marketing efforts and scheduling showings.
– Week 5-6: Receiving offers and engaging in negotiations.
– Week 7-8: Closing preparations and final inspections.
– Week 9: Closing the sale and transferring ownership.
